Charlotte 1980

Charlotte Motor Speedway 1980 Tim Brewer Jeff Hammond

Charlotte Motor Speedway | © 1980 David Allio

1980 May 25 | Sunday: Crew chief Tim Brewer (left) and car owner Junior Johnson watch as jackman Jeff Hammond prepares to lower the car following a tire change on the Cale Yarborough (11) Junior Johnson Chevrolet Monte Carlo during a pitstop in the 21st Annual World 600 NASCAR Winston Cup Grand National event at Charlotte Motor Speedway in Harrisburg, North Carolina.

Comments are closed.